io.net, formerly known as ANTBIT, leverages a decentralized computing network powered by Solana and Aptos to provide machine learning engineers with access to distributed cloud clusters. It aims to address challenges like limited availability, poor choice, and high costs associated with accessing GPUs in the public cloud.

This service allows liquidity providers to earn extra liquidity mining rewards and trading fees. It also helps protocols attract and maintain liquidity effectively. Izumi improves incentive distribution through its LiquidBox, allowing rewards to be allocated within specific price ranges.
